Home
last modified time | relevance | path

Searched refs:GroupOperation (Results 1 – 6 of 6) sorted by relevance

/openbsd-src/gnu/llvm/llvm/lib/Target/SPIRV/
H A DSPIRVModuleAnalysis.cpp833 case SPIRV::GroupOperation::Reduce: in addInstrRequirements()
834 case SPIRV::GroupOperation::InclusiveScan: in addInstrRequirements()
835 case SPIRV::GroupOperation::ExclusiveScan: in addInstrRequirements()
840 case SPIRV::GroupOperation::ClusteredReduce: in addInstrRequirements()
843 case SPIRV::GroupOperation::PartitionedReduceNV: in addInstrRequirements()
844 case SPIRV::GroupOperation::PartitionedInclusiveScanNV: in addInstrRequirements()
845 case SPIRV::GroupOperation::PartitionedExclusiveScanNV: in addInstrRequirements()
H A DSPIRVSymbolicOperands.td1429 // Multiclass used to define GroupOperation enum values and at the same time
1434 def GroupOperation : GenericEnum, Operand<i32> {
1435 let FilterClass = "GroupOperation";
1441 class GroupOperation<string name, bits<32> value> {
1447 def NAME : GroupOperation<NAME, value>;
H A DSPIRVInstrInfo.td679 (ins TYPE:$ty, ID:$scope, GroupOperation:$groupOp, ID:$x),
731 (ins TYPE:$ty, ID:$scope, GroupOperation:$groupOp, ID:$val),
741 (ins TYPE:$ty, ID:$scope, GroupOperation:$groupOp,
H A DSPIRVBuiltins.cpp68 uint32_t GroupOperation; member
876 MIB.addImm(GroupBuiltin->GroupOperation); in generateGroupInst()
H A DSPIRVBuiltins.td578 bits<32> GroupOperation = !cond(!not(!eq(!find(name, "group_reduce"), -1)) : Reduce.Value,
623 let Fields = ["Name", "Opcode", "GroupOperation", "IsElect", "IsAllOrAny",
/openbsd-src/gnu/llvm/llvm/lib/Target/SPIRV/MCTargetDesc/
H A DSPIRVBaseInfo.h169 namespace GroupOperation {